Paumanok Environmental - Comprehensive Analysis Report
Summary
Paumanok Environmental, established in 2015, is a key player in waste management and environmental services on Long Island, New York. The company operates permitted construction and demolition (C&D) debris handling and recovery facilities, as well as transfer facilities, in Yaphank and Southampton. Its core mission revolves around providing comprehensive waste management and recycling solutions, emphasizing environmentally sound practices to transition recyclable materials into valuable products. Paumanok Environmental is significant in its industry for contributing to job creation, economic support, and landfill space conservation through its focus on responsible recycling and waste reduction efforts in partnership with local communities.

Specialization Areas
The company specializes in handling various waste streams, including Construction & Demolition (C&D) Debris, mixed municipal solid waste (MSW), industrial waste, clean wood, and concrete. Its unique value proposition lies in operating permitted transfer and recovery facilities that facilitate the local processing of these materials, contributing to a circular economy model.

Construction & Demolition (C&D) Debris Handling and Recovery:
Description: Collection, processing, and recovery of materials such as asphalt millings, asphalt pavement, brick, concrete, gravel, gypsum wallboard, and unadulterated wood from construction and demolition sites.
Development Stage: Fully operational.
Target Market/Condition: Construction companies, demolition contractors, and building material suppliers in Suffolk County.
Key Features and Benefits: Reduces landfill waste, promotes material reuse and recycling, offers a cost-effective and environmentally responsible disposal method.

Market Overview
The global environmental consulting market is experiencing robust growth, with projections indicating a rise from an estimated USD 46.50 billion in 2025 to USD 62.25 billion by 2030, reflecting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.01%. Other estimates suggest a growth to approximately USD 92.85 billion by 2034 from USD 46.67 billion in 2025, at a CAGR of 7.95%. This expansion is primarily fueled by tightening environmental regulations, increasing corporate sustainability mandates, global climate change mitigation efforts, and heightened public awareness of environmental issues.
Key trends shaping the market include a strong focus on renewable energy projects, comprehensive waste management and recycling initiatives, strategies for climate change adaptation, and efficient water resource management. The industry is also witnessing significant integration of advanced technologies such as artificial intelligence, remote sensing, and sophisticated data analytics to enhance service delivery and operational efficiency.
North America maintains a significant share of this market, with the U.S. environmental consulting industry alone valued at an estimated $27.4 billion in 2025, growing at a CAGR of 2.6% from 2020-2025. High-value segments like Environmental Impact Assessment, which held 30.87% of the market in 2024, and ESG Reporting and Sustainability Strategy, projected to grow at a 6.23% CAGR to 2030, demonstrate strong demand.
